5-2-10: NOTICE TO OWNER AND REDEMPTION:
Upon taking possession of any dog, the officer, shall take all steps to notify the owner, or if the owner is unknown, written notice shall be posted for three (3) days upon the bulletin board at the town clerk's office in the town hall, describing the dog, the place, and time of taking. The owner of any dog so impounded may reclaim such dog upon the payment of the license fee, if unpaid, and of all costs and charges incurred by the town for impounding and maintenance of such dog, as follows:
   A.   For impounding any unlicensed dog, fifty dollars ($50.00);
   B.   For impounding a licensed dog, fifteen dollars ($15.00) for the first offense; thirty five dollars ($35.00) for the second offense; and seventy dollars ($70.00) for the third offense or any subsequent offenses, provided that such second and subsequent offenses occur within the same license year. These fees are in addition to all boarding fees;
   C.   For transporting a dog to the animal shelter, one hundred twenty five dollars ($125.00). (Ord. 135, 11-5-2010)
